Table 2 Scope of variations in mattress designs

From: Assessment of factors affecting fire performance of mattresses: a review

Mattress parameters

Description

Variations

Height

Between 10.16 cm and 50.8 cm (4 in and 20 in)

 

Sizes

Twin (96.5 cm x 187.9 cm ( 38 in x 74 in)), Full (134.6 cm x 187.9 cm (53in x 74 in)), Queen (152.4 cm x 203.2 cm (60 in x 80 in)), King ( 193.0 cm x 203.2 cm (76 in x 80 in)) and California King (182.8 cm x 213.3 cm (72 in x 84 in))

5

Construction

Single-sided and double-sided

2

Mattress geometry

Smooth top, Tight top, Pillow top, Super pillow top, Euro top, Box pillow top.

6

Mattress core

Open coil with or without foam encasement, Pocket coil with or without foam encasement, Foam, Viscoelastic, Latex, and Air

8

Foundation geometry

Steel/wood box continental (22.8 cm (9 in)) and 7.6 cm (3in)); Steel/wood Taped (22.8 cm (9 in) and 7.6 cm (3in)); Wood box (22.8 cm (9in)); Wood box, cardboard taped ( 5.0 cm (2in )); No box

7

Upholstery/ fillings

Numerous combinations of fiber, fabric and foams

~ 100

Ticking

Highly variable

> 1000

Total variations excluding ticking variations: 5 x 2 x 6 x 8 x 7 x100 =

> 336,000
